Background technology
Smart mobile phone is from producing to till now, and amusement function is increasingly enriched, playability more and more higher, such as watches electricity Shadow, checks picture etc., it is one of indispensable function that photograph album, which is browsed,.When photograph album is browsed generally by external device, work( Energy button or right button menu complete the scaling of picture, it usually needs both hands zoom picture, so must bimanualness It can achieve the goal, be brought some inconvenience to user, and the degree of scaling also can not be controlled accurately.Current many intelligent terminals There is gravity sensor in equipment, it is possible to use gravity sensor detects the change of three dimensions, computational intelligence terminal device is worked as Preceding gravity direction, so that picture is that transverse screen show or portrait layout is shown when controlling the photograph album to browse, it is that can control display side To, but there is no this law control to display size, and the region that this technology is specified using gravity sensing on zoom picture, make The purpose of zoom picture can be just reached with one-handed performance, operates and more facilitates, more there is playability.

Embodiment
Referring to accompanying drawing 1, a kind of method for changing picture display size based on gravity sensor, including:(1) photograph album is opened to enter Enter browsing pictures pattern, browsing pictures pattern has picture rotation pattern and picture zoom mode, it is main here to be contracted using size Mode playback;(2) under browsing pictures pattern, registration monitor monitors screen state, and record finger clicks on the time of screen, if Finger clicks on screen and exceedes predetermined time 3s, then is determined as long click screen;(3) register gravity sensor, monitor perpendicular to The acceleration of gravity of screen orientation, selectes effective screen coordinate face here, then the tilting action of mobile terminal is in effective seat Effective action is projected as on mark face, invalid action is projected as on other perspective planes;(4) become with the inclined degree of mobile phone Change, the acceleration of gravity of normal to screen changes, when changing value is more than the change in size for then causing picture in predetermined scope, tool For body when monitoring the normal to screen direction acceleration of gravity become it is big when amplification picture, acceleration become hour reduce figure Piece;(5) when finger is lifted from screen, cancel and monitor gravity sensing, the moment picture decontroled in finger also stops change, and Keep current size.
